How they compare
Malaysia currently reports -223 Mt CO2e against -485.47 Mt CO2e in India, a difference of 262.47 Mt CO2e.
The two have swapped places 4 times across 24 shared years of data; in 2000 it was Malaysia ahead.
India ranks 180th and Malaysia ranks 178th of 183 countries.
Across the 3 decades both report, India averaged higher in 1 and Malaysia in 2.
